- Added hostname provisioning - Added nsswitch.conf provisioning - Added systemd-resolved provisioning
12 lines
440 B
Django/Jinja
12 lines
440 B
Django/Jinja
# {{ ansible_managed }}
|
|
|
|
[Interface]
|
|
Address={{ vpn_media_peers.tv.ip }}/24
|
|
DNS={{ vpn_media_listen_address }}
|
|
PrivateKey={{ lookup('file', vpn_media_peers.tv.private_key_source_path) }}
|
|
|
|
[Peer]
|
|
PublicKey={{ lookup('file', vpn_media_server_public_key_source_path) }}
|
|
PresharedKey={{ lookup('file', vpn_media_peers.tv.preshared_key_source_path) }}
|
|
AllowedIPs={{ vpn_media_listen_address }}/32
|
|
Endpoint={{ domain_name }}:{{ vpn_media_port }}
|